The Data Engineer is responsible for designing, building, testing, and maintaining the data infrastructure and architecture that supports the efficient, reliable, and secure processing of structured and unstructured data. This role works closely with Data Analysts, Data Scientists, and business stakeholders to understand data requirements, identify data sources, and implement scalable data pipelines. The Data Engineer ensures data integrity, availability, and security throughout the data lifecycle and continuously optimizes data processes to meet evolving business needs. Essential Qualifications & Experience: A minimum requirement of a Bachelor's degree at a nationally recognised/certified University in a related discipline, such as Computer Science, Data Science and Engineering, and postrelated experience. Or exceptionally, the lack of a university degree may be compensated by the demonstration of a candidate's particular abilities or experience that is/are of interest to NCIA, that is, at least 6 years extensive and progressive expertise in duties related to the function of the post. Experience: • Strong understanding of data engineering concepts, including data warehousing, ETL/ELT processes and data governance • Experience in planning and maintaining data lakes and pipeline processes, both batch-wise and (near) real-time; • Experience in using of data engineering tools to support development of data science, data analytics and AI applications for both, structured and unstructured, data • Experience with monitoring and logging tools to ensure the reliability and performance of data pipelines and AI systems. • Solid understanding of containerization and orchestration tools such as Docker and Kubernetes. • Experience with cloud platforms such as AWS, Google Cloud or Azure • Solid understanding of good software development principles such as version control, CI/CD, unit/functional testing. • Strong proficiency in Python for building and integrating various data engineering components • Solid understanding of data security best practices, including data encryption, access controls, authentication/authorization mechanisms, and compliance requirements.
